A U.S. Soldier with the 62nd Engineers, 104th Engineer Construction Company, from Ft. Hood, Tx., ground guides a Heavy Expanded Mobility Tactical Truck (HEMTT) as it readies to pull debris from a road at Muscatatuck Urban Training Center in Butlerville, Ind., during Guardian Response 19, a homeland emergency response exercise which tests the ability of the military to respond to a manmade or natural disaster on April 30, 2019. The Soldiers are responding to a city following a mock nuclear detonation, so they must don gas masks and protective equipment while working. (U.S. Army photo by Master Sgt. Brad Staggs)
